In the last decade, the topic of motherhood has emerged as a distinct and established field of scholarly inquiry. A cursory review of motherhood research reveals that hundreds of scholarly articles have been published on almost every motherhood theme imaginable. The Encyclopedia of Motherhood is a collection of approximately 700 articles in a three-volume, A-to-Z set exploring major topics related to motherhood, from geographical, historical and cultural entries to anthropological and psychological contributions. In human society, few institutions are as important as motherhood, and this unique encyclopedia captures the interdisciplinary foundation of the subject in one convenient reference. The Encyclopedia is a comprehensive resource designed to provide an understanding of the complexities of motherhood for academic and public libraries, and is written by academics and institutional experts in the social and behavioural sciences.

In January 2016, Billi J Miller launched her first published book (a four-and-a-half year labour of love) celebrating “traditional” farmwives (between the ages of fifty-five and ninety) for their remarkable contributions to their families, farms, and to the wider scope of Canadian heritage. Farmwives in Profile: 17 Women, 17 Candid Questions about their Lives, Photos & Recipes has been hailed a “gem” for its candid stories, delicious straight-from-the-farm-kitchen recipes, and Miller’s timeless photographs of the women. Now it’s the “next generations” turn. Farmwives 2: An Inspiring Look at the Lives of the New Canadian Farmwives is the highly anticipated follow-up that hones in on women in their twenties to fifties. This time, Miller interviews women from across the country— from British Columbia all the way to Newfoundland—broadening not only the look at Canada’s family farms but, women’s perspectives on this evolving role. "Farmwives 2" is loaded with all-new recipes, many more inspiring interviews, and features a special "Food for Thought" section filled with input by professionals you won't want to miss. Miller says she walked into this life eight years ago with no guidebook other than very traditional farmwives all around her, and a feeling in her gut that told her she had to make her life her own. This book is packed with interviews and stories from inspiring women from across Canada who are doing that very thing.

Growing up in post-World War II Alberta in a stable, loving home, Tom Symington didn’t feel that he was “different.” Evading early pressures of romance and sexual exploration, repressing instances of name-calling (“femmy”), and hostility from schoolmates, Tom was almost able to believe in a world that valued the rights and freedoms of all citizens. From Calgary to Sierra Leone to France, this candid, heartbreaking memoir braids the evolution of gay rights in Canada with the life journey of one individual. Following high school, as Tom entered university and became a teacher, he was forced to reconcile his sexual orientation with the prevailing social and legal environment in Alberta, Canada, and the world beyond. As decades passed, “femmy” merged with “gay,” “queer,” and “LGBTQ+ community” in a rallying movement and an enduring struggle towards pride and self-acceptance against the current of societal expectations and discriminatory legislation. Not So Normal is as much a coming-of-age odyssey and a celebration of selfhood as it is a grave reminder that there is still much work to be done in the realm of human rights, and an urgent call to action to recentre love in our increasingly diverse and divisive world.

Thirteen-year-old Rabia, along with her mother and younger brother, flee Afghanistan and the brutal Taliban for Pakistan. Some months later, they take part in a program that is relocating refugee widows and orphans to America. However, their flight falls on the fateful morning of 9/11. After the terrorist attack on the World Trade Center in New York City, their plane is diverted to Gander, Newfoundland. Also on the plane is an American boy named Colin, who struggles with his prejudices against Rabia and her family after they are all stuck in Gander while the air space is shut down. The people in the small community (including teens Jason and Leah) open their hearts and their homes to the stranded passengers, volunteering to billet the hundreds of unexpected visitors to the island. Their kindness might be the bridge to understanding and acceptance that Colin and Rabia need.
